Principal Financial Group (NASDAQ:PFG - Get Free Report) posted its earnings results on Monday. The company reported $2.16 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.98 by $0.18, Zacks reports. Principal Financial Group had a net margin of 6.89% and a return on equity of 14.85%.
Principal Financial Group Stock Down 0.8%
NASDAQ PFG traded down $0.66 on Monday, hitting $80.39. 1,677,397 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 1,400,370. The company has a quick ratio of 0.28, a current ratio of 0.28 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.38. The firm has a market capitalization of $18.02 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 17.21, a PEG ratio of 0.83 and a beta of 0.99. Principal Financial Group has a 52-week low of $68.39 and a 52-week high of $91.97.

Principal Financial Group, Inc provides retirement, asset management, and insurance products and services to businesses, individuals, and institutional clients worldwide. The company operates through Retirement and Income Solutions, Principal Global Investors, Principal International, and U.S. Insurance Solutions segments.
